概括
脑癌的放射治疗可以导致由于脑损伤而导致认知衰退 (RICD). 解决方案包括神经保护,认知康复,先进的成像和个性化医疗来支持幸存者.

背景情况:
- 中枢神经系统癌症的放射治疗可以导致辐射诱导的认知衰退 (RICD).
- RICD涉及到记忆和注意力受损,源于白质损伤,炎症和氧化应激.
- 这种情况的复杂性源于各种损伤机制和诸如年龄和并发症等混因素.

主要成果:
- RICD是多因素的,涉及神经发生,氧化应激,炎症和血管影响.
- 神经保护剂,认知康复,先进的成像和质子疗法显示出有希望的结果.
- 个性化医学和再生疗法为未来的治疗提供了新的途径.
结论:
- 管理RICD需要一个多学科的方法,整合各种治疗策略.
- 个性化医疗和新兴疗法,如干细胞治疗,对RICD具有重大潜力.
- 解决认知衰退对于改善癌症幸存者的生活质量至关重要.

Dementia
107
Dementia is a collective term for cognitive disorders primarily affecting memory, thinking, and reasoning. It is not a specific disease but a syndrome, with Alzheimer's disease being the most common cause, accounting for approximately 60-80% of cases. Other types include vascular dementia, Lewy body dementia, and frontotemporal dementia. Dementia affects millions worldwide, particularly older adults, though it is not a normal part of aging.

Biological Effects of Radiation
15.4K
All radioactive nuclides emit high-energy particles or electromagnetic waves. When this radiation encounters living cells, it can cause heating, break chemical bonds, or ionize molecules. The most serious biological damage results when these radioactive emissions fragment or ionize molecules.
